Try Adobe Audition.  Used to be CoolEdit, but Adobe bought it out.

128 track mixing ability.  Various digital effects.  Burn to CD directly.  All in all, not a bad program.  Supports a couple of plug-in formats, so it extensible.

Not as good as Steinberg's products, but not nearly as pricey either.
